Need a recommendation for most suitable amp for KEF LS50 METAs by darkflight666 in KEF

[–]FingerPatient8528 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Marantz MM7025 (used or referb). Plenty of power and a great brand pairing for hard to drive bookshelf speakers. The LS50 while they have an 8 ohm load aren’t very sensitive. Current delivery, damping factor, headroom, and amp characteristics should be considered. Happy hunting.

What cd player? by Mission-Barber5899 in hifiaudio

[–]FingerPatient8528 2 points3 points  (0 children)

The only used players that come to mind within your budget are the Denon DCD-1650GL and the Denon DCD-S10 (any version). I own them both and can vouch for their performance. They were very serious players when they debuted. Finding one in good to fair condition is a win. And yes I would consider both of these to be better players than the CD6007.
